In today's show Gary sat down with Minister of Mines and Energy, Tom Alweendo to catch up on where we are, where we're going, and how we get there without stumbling where some other countries have. He also found out a lot more about former Springbok rugby player and now successful businessman Bryan Habana in the Spotlight feature. David meanwhile spoke to Namibia Breweries Financial Director, Waldemar von Lieres about their recently published results (of course the Heineken deal also came up...) and Zahra Baite-Boateng about the Africa's Business Heroes prize competition and how Namibians can stand a chance of walking away with one of the prizes.
